Block 3960663

0x81783ad4d88c764f2a89e8d23a9959b0399d74d617e896b188a8d98934a60639
Transactions4
Height3960663
Confirmations17859386
TimestampThu, 22 Jun 2017 20:14:42 UTC
Size (bytes)1192
Version
Merkle Root
Nonce0x8b91d1c0037cd3ec
Bits
Difficulty0x307c7b5bd2a2

Transactions

Fee: 0.0035264 ETC
17859386 Confirmations708.4971537 ETC
Fee: 0.00072326 ETC
17859386 Confirmations0.1083144 ETC
Fee: 0.00042 ETC
17859386 Confirmations1.002324639 ETC
Fee: 0.00072326 ETC
17859386 Confirmations2.9964801 ETC